*The Center for Frontiers of Subsurface Energy Security (CFSES) is seeking
five new R&D post-doctoral fellows to work at Sandia National Laboratories
(Sandia). *CFSES is an Energy Frontier Research Center funded by the U.S.
Department of Energy, Office of Science. The objective of CFSES is to
understand and control emergent behavior arising from coupled physics and
chemistry of geologic carbon dioxide storage in heterogeneous geomaterials.
CFSES is a partnership between Sandia and the University of Texas at Austin.

*Experimental Geomechanics (ID# 646223)* conduct fracture propagation, rock
deformation, and bulk rock strengthening/weakening experiments to develop
and
validate constitutive hydro-mechanical-chemical models.
*Geochemistry (ID# 646225)* use laboratory experiments to examine how
geochemical changes during reactions with carbon dioxide and brine control
the geomechanical behavior of caprocks and reservoir rocks.
*Computational Fracture Mechanics (ID# 646179)* contribute to computational
fracture mechanics with an emphasis on local crack-tip and phase-field
modeling and multiscale/multiphysics coupling with pore-scale models.
Develop
fundamental models of multiphase flow in heterogeneous capillary-porous
media.
*Molecular Simulation (ID# 646226)* contribute to classical molecular
simulation of bulk and interfacial phenomena associated with multifluids,
and
the interaction of water and carbon dioxide in clay interlayers, for
comparison to experimental findings.
*Multiphase Flow Experiments and Modeling (ID# 646224)* experimentally and
numerically characterize capillary/buoyancy driven flow of carbon dioxide
from pore to meter scale and develop upscaling techniques for multiphase
flow
and reactive transport.
